首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

Makefile递归方法问题

Makefile是一种用于自动化构建和管理软件项目的工具。它使用一个名为Makefile的文件来定义一系列规则和依赖关系,以便在编译、链接和安装过程中自动执行必要的操作。

递归方法是指在Makefile中调用其他Makefile的技术。通过递归方法,可以将一个大型项目分解为多个子项目,并在每个子项目的Makefile中定义规则和依赖关系。这样可以更好地组织和管理项目的构建过程。

递归方法的优势在于可以将复杂的项目分解为更小的模块,使得项目结构更清晰,便于维护和扩展。同时,递归方法还可以提高构建的效率,因为只有在子项目发生变化时才需要重新构建。

递归方法在各种类型的项目中都有广泛的应用场景。例如,当一个项目由多个子模块组成时,可以使用递归方法来分别构建每个子模块,并在最后将它们合并成一个完整的项目。此外,递归方法还可以用于构建具有多个平台或配置的项目,以及构建具有多个目标的项目。

腾讯云提供了一系列与构建和部署相关的产品,可以帮助开发者更好地使用Makefile递归方法。其中,腾讯云代码托管(CodeCommit)可以用于存储和管理代码,腾讯云云原生应用引擎(TKE)可以用于部署和管理容器化应用,腾讯云云函数(SCF)可以用于部署和管理无服务器函数。这些产品可以与Makefile递归方法结合使用,提供全面的构建和部署解决方案。

更多关于腾讯云相关产品的介绍和详细信息,请访问腾讯云官方网站:https://cloud.tencent.com/

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

  • 领券